最新活动:电脑PC端+手机端+微网站+自适应网页多模板选择-建站388元起价!!!
当前位置:主页 > 网站建设 > 掌握CSS3D关键技术如何使用translate、rotate和scalc

掌握CSS3D关键技术如何使用translate、rotate和scalc

时间:2023-05-27 11:05:27 阅读: 文章分类: 网站建设 作者: 网站编辑员

导读:cms教程cms教程在现代web开发中,使用CSS3D技术创造3D效果已经成为了一种趋势。该技术可以为网站带来更加生动的用户体验,并为网站的设计提供更加丰富的空间。本文将介绍CSSseo网站优化培训seo网站优化。

seo网站优化培训seo网站优化

在现代 web 开发中,使用 CSS3D 技术创造 3D 效果已经成为了一种趋势。建设网站该技术可以为网站带来更加生动的用户体验,并为网站的设计提供更加丰富的空间。本文将介绍 CSS3D 关键技术,并详细讲解如何使用 translate、rotate 和 scale 等属性。

一、CSS3D 关键技术

CSS3D 技术允许开发人员在平面网网站建设公司页上添加 3D 特效,使网页具有更吸引人的视觉效果。在实现 3D 效果时,我们需要注意以下几个要点:

  • 创建 3D 空间:通过 CSS transform 技术创建一个 3D 空间。
  • 定义 3D 特征:通过 translate, rotate 和 scale 等关键属性定义 3D 特征。
  • 定位元素:通过定位元素,将元素放置在定义好的 3D 空间中。
  • 二、使用 translate 属性创建平移效果

    在 CSS3D 中,translate 属性用于控制网页元素在 3D 空间中的位置。通过定义 x, y 和 z 轴上的平移距离,我们可以使元素在 3D 空间中水平、垂直或者前后移动。以下代码演示了如何使用 translate 属性在 x, y 和 z 轴上移动元素的位置。

    .box { transform: translate3d(50px, 50px, 0); }

    以上代码会使 .box 元素在 3D 空间中 x, y 轴方向上各往右下移动 50px。

    三、使用 rotate 属性创建旋转效果

    rotate 属性同样用于在 3D 空间中定义元素的位置。通过指定元素绕 x, y 或 z 轴旋转的角度和方向,我们可以在 3D 空间中创建各种旋转效果。以下代码演示了如何使用 rotate 属性创建一个在 z 方向上旋转的元素的效果。

    .box { transform: rotateZ(45deg); }

    以上代码会使如何seo优化推广网站 .box 元素在 3D 空间中绕 z 轴旋转 45 度。

    四、使用 scale 属性创建缩放效果

    在 CSS3D 中,我们还可以使用 scale 属性来缩放元素在 3D 空间中的大小。以下代码演示了如何使用 scale 属性将 .box 元素放大 2 倍。

    .box { transform: scale3d(2, 2, 2); }

    以上代码会将 .box 元素在 3D 空间中放大 2 倍。

    五、总结

    通过以上的介绍,我们了解了如何使用 CSS3D 技术在网页上创建 3D 特效,并通过控制 translate、rotate 和 scale 等属性控制元素在 3D 空间中的位置。这些技术为我们提供了一个全新的创作空间,为网页设计师带来了更多的可能性。在使用时,我们需要注意定义好 3D 空间并选择合适的属性实现想要的效果,才能使我们的网页在视觉效果上更具有吸引力。

    相关seo网站优化培训seo网站优化。

    关键词标签: 属性 元素 cms教程

    声明: 本文由我的SEOUC技术文章主页发布于:2023-05-27 ,文章掌握CSS3D关键技术如何使用translate、rotate和scalc主要讲述属性,元素,cms教程网站建设源码以及服务器配置搭建相关技术文章。转载请保留链接: https://www.seouc.com/article/web_11159.html

    我的IDC 网站建设技术SEOUC.COM
    专注网站建设,SEO优化,小程序设计制作搭建开发定制网站等,数千家网站定制开发案例,网站推广技术服务。
  • 5000+合作客服
  • 8年从业经验
  • 150+覆盖行业
  • 最新热门源码技术文章